Warehouse Manager manages warehouse operations and processes. Oversees receiving and stowing, picking and packing, shipping, inventory management, and documentation. Being a Warehouse Manager optimizes efficient layouts, workflows, and utilization of warehouse space. Monitors the safety and security of goods and materials. Additionally, Warehouse Manager utilizes a warehouse management system (WMS), enterprise resource system (ERP), or other system to track and analyze processes and performance. Implements strong safety polices and procedures. Typically requires a bachelor's degree or equivalent. Typically reports to a head of a unit/department. The Warehouse Manager manages subordinate staff in the day-to-day performance of their jobs. True first level manager. Ensures that project/department milestones/goals are met and adhering to approved budgets. Has full authority for personnel actions. To be a Warehouse Manager typically requires 5 years experience in the related area as an individual contributor. 1 - 3 years supervisory experience may be required. Key responsibilities:
• Design, establish, manage and maintain the warehousing/materials control facility and operation at the designated warehouse/work site/client facility
• Complete receivers for shipments, clients instrument, electrical group, and the commissioning group purchase orders.
• Direct the request for materials from construction contractors, piping, electrical and instrumentation equipment, by verifying the materials on site and quantities to be issued, along with ensuring that the material has not been requested previously by verifying the ISO number against what has been already issued.
• Once the materials are verified for issue to the contractor, the issue sheets are given to materials coordinator to pull and issue. Once issue sheets are signed, the sheets are returned for spread sheet update for the quantities and the receivers forwarded to all concerned personnel.
• Track all the materials that commissioning orders and then to warehousing to keep up with orders being placed, work with expediter on all orders, Wood, Client (electrical, instrument and piping) to receipt and ensure that all necessary related documents and forward to close Expediter records and spreadsheets, and so that Goods Receipts can be completed by Client personnel to ensure prompt material receipt verification is completed so invoices can be approved for payment.
•Identify any shortages, overages, or damages, and take corrective action to correct the issues with the supplier, working with expediter for quick resolution.
• Work closely with Client warehouse personnel to assist in making sure the Subcontractors materials that come in by UPS or FedEx are identified and delivered to the appropriate drop areas.
• Ensure the efficient operation of and continuously monitor the efficiency and performance of the warehouse operations, including the utilisation of labour
• Establishes priorities, assigns workloads and reviews the more difficult and complex aspects of the materials and logistics workload.
• Establish and monitor project material control systems, including customised project reporting.
• Accountable for all Freight Forwarding and Import / Export and Customs control activities, and compliance thereof.
• Responsible for developing and implementing strategies for identification, minimising and management of project surplus and scrap materials.
KPI reporting and performance including positive identification checks / stock turns as appropriate • Development and implementation of inventory/material management strategies that improve efficiency for Wood and our clients, including but not limited to Kanban, use of consignment stocks, FIFO/min – max levels, track and trace.
• Accountable for the management of Inventory in accordance with required inventory regime and ensuring accuracy thereof by monitoring of warehouse activity, cycle counts and stock checks and the maintaining of data integrity in material management systems.
• Accountable for the application of correct maintenance and preservation of inventory/materials for stored equipment and the assurance thereof.
